The Uttar Pradesh Public Service Commission (UPPSC) has declared the UPPSC PCS Mains Result 2025 on 17 September 2026, and thousands of aspirants across Uttar Pradesh are now rushing to check their roll numbers. This result covers the Combined State or Upper Subordinate Services (Main) Examination 2025, held under Advertisement No. A-1/E-1/2025. UPPSC PCS Mains Result 2025: Overview & Key Highlights
Before diving into the details, here is a quick snapshot of everything that matters. Think of this table as your one-stop dashboard. You can glance at it and know exactly where things stand, without scrolling through pages of text.
| Particulars | Details |
| Conducting Body | Uttar Pradesh Public Service Commission (UPPSC) |
| Examination | Combined State / Upper Subordinate Services (Main) Exam 2025 |
| Advertisement No. | A-1/E-1/2025 |
| Notice Number | 01/02/C-1/P.C.S.-2025/2025-26 |
| Mains Exam Dates | 29 March to 1 April 2026 |
| Exam Centres | Prayagraj and Lucknow districts |
| Candidates Appeared | 10,284 |
| Total Vacancies | 814 (across 28 post types) |
| Vacancies Through Interview | 812 |
| Result Declared On | 17 September 2026 |
| Candidates Qualified for Interview | 2,297 |
| Next Stage | Interview and Document Verification |
| Official Website | uppsc.up.nic.in |
Out of 10,284 candidates who appeared for the Mains exam, only 2,297 have been provisionally declared qualified for the interview round. That works out to roughly 1 in every 4.5 candidates making the cut. The result was announced through a press note released from the Commission’s Prayagraj office, and the roll number list was simultaneously put up on the notice board at UPPSC headquarters and uploaded to the official website.

UPPSC PCS Mains Cut Off 2025: Category-wise Qualifying Marks
Here is an important point that many aspirants miss. Along with this Mains result, UPPSC has not released the actual marks or the final category-wise cut off. Only the list of qualified roll numbers has been published. The detailed marks and cut off are typically released later, usually alongside the final result after the interview stage is complete. So if you are searching for an official cut off PDF right now, it genuinely does not exist yet.
That said, UPPSC rules do lay out the minimum qualifying percentage that every candidate must cross to even be considered for the merit list. This works like a basic pass mark, separate from the actual closing cut off.
| Category | Percentage | Marks |
|---|---|---|
| General/OBC/EWS | 40% | 600/1500 |
| SC/ST | 35% | 525/1500 |
Crossing this minimum percentage does not guarantee a place on the qualified list. Think of it like the minimum height requirement for a ride at an amusement park. It lets you stand in the queue, but it does not guarantee you a seat. The actual closing cut-off depends on how many candidates apply for each category, how tough the paper was, and how many vacancies are available that year.

UPPSC PCS Mains Merit List 2025: Qualified Candidates Details
A total of 2,297 candidates have been provisionally qualified for the interview stage this year, against 812 vacancies that will be filled through interview out of the total 814 posts on offer. The remaining 2 posts are filled purely on the basis of written exam marks, without an interview.
A few things worth understanding about this merit list:
- The number of candidates called for interview is always kept higher than the actual number of vacancies. This gives the Commission a reasonable buffer, since some candidates drop out, fail document verification, or decline the post for personal reasons.
- This list is described as provisional. Final selection still depends on your performance in the interview, plus successful document verification.
- The complete roll number list is also displayed physically on the notice board at the UPPSC office in Prayagraj, in addition to being published online.
- No category-wise breakup of the merit list, such as how many General, OBC, SC, ST, or EWS candidates qualified, has been shared publicly with this result.

What After UPPSC PCS Mains Result 2025? Next Steps Explained
Qualifying the Mains exam is a huge milestone, but the journey is not over yet. Here is what typically happens next in the UPPSC selection process:
- Document verification: You will need to get your original educational certificates, category certificates, age proof, and identity documents ready and verified.
- Interview call letter: UPPSC will release a separate notification with the interview schedule, along with individual call letters for candidates.
- Personality test or interview: This is conducted by a panel and generally checks your communication skills, general awareness, and administrative aptitude, rather than testing rote knowledge.
- Final merit list: After the interview, your written exam marks and interview marks are combined to prepare the final merit list, which decides your actual post and service.

UPPSC PCS Interview 2025: Dates, Schedule & Required Documents
As of now, UPPSC has not announced the exact interview dates. The official notification simply states that the schedule will be “notified soon.” Based on how the Commission has handled previous cycles, interviews are usually spread across several weeks, since thousands of candidates need to be called in smaller batches.
While you wait for the exact dates, it makes sense to start preparing your documents. Here is a general checklist that most candidates are asked to bring for verification:
- High school and intermediate mark sheets and certificates, for age and education proof
- Graduation degree certificate and final year mark sheet
- Category certificate, such as OBC, SC, ST, or EWS, issued by the competent authority, if applicable
- Domicile or residence certificate of Uttar Pradesh
- Aadhaar card or another valid government photo identity proof
- Recent passport-size photographs, matching the specifications mentioned in your admit card
- Mains admit card and the printed copy of your result confirmation
- Disability certificate, if you have applied under the PwBD category
